SetCellBorderTop
function SetCellBorderTop(
sType: BorderType = null,
nSize: pt_8 = null,
nSpace: pt = null,
r: byte = null,
g: byte = null,
b: byte = null,
): void
Description
Sets the border which will be displayed at the top of the current table cell.
Parameters
The cell top border style.
The width of the current cell top border measured in eighths of a point.
The spacing offset in the top part of the table cell measured in points used to place this border.
Red color component value.
Green color component value.
Blue color component value.
Returns
void
Try It
var oDocument = Api.GetDocument();
var oParagraph = oDocument.GetElement(0);
oParagraph.AddText("We create a 3x3 table and add the top 4 point black border to all cells:");
var oTableStyle = oDocument.CreateStyle("CustomTableStyle", "table");
oTableStyle.SetBasedOn(oDocument.GetStyle("Bordered"));
var oTable = Api.CreateTable(3, 3);
oTable.SetWidth("percent", 100);
var oTableCellPr = oTableStyle.GetTableCellPr();
oTableCellPr.SetCellBorderTop("single", 32, 0, 51, 51, 51);
oTable.SetStyle(oTableStyle);
oDocument.Push(oTable);